您好,欢迎访问一九零五行业门户网

西门子S7-300模拟量输入模块SM331

1概述
s7协议是siemens s7系列产品之间通讯使用的标准协议 ,其优点是通信双方无论是在同一mpi总线上、同一profibus总线上或同一工业以太网中,都可通过s7协议建立通信连接,使用相同的编程方式进行数 据交换而与使用何种总线或网络无关。s7通信分为按组态方式可分为单边通信和双边通信,单边通信通常应用于以下情况:
• 通信伙伴无法组态s7连接
• 通信伙伴无法停机
• 不希望在通讯伙伴侧增加通信组态或程序
本文介绍s7-400基于profibus总线的s7单边通信的组态步骤。
实验环境,见表1。
序号 名称 订货号
1 cr3导轨 6es7 401-1da01-0aa0
2 ps407 6es7 407-0ka02-0aa0
3 cpu414-3 6es7 414-3xm05-0ab0
4 cpu315-2 dp 6es7 315-2ah14-0ab0
5 profibus 标准电缆 6xv1 830-0eh10
6 rs485总线连接器 6es7972-0bb42-0xa0
7 step7 v5.5 sp2
8 windows xp sp3
表1
2 组态
2.1配置s7-400站点
s7-400站点配置参见表2。
序号 说明 图示
1. 创建新项目并在项目中插入s7-400站点
2. 打开硬件组态,组态s7-400站点
3. 在硬件目录中查找使用的导轨型号,并双击找到的导轨型号
4. 在硬件目录选择使用的电源,并拖拽到导轨的1号槽
5. 在硬件目录选择使用的cpu,并拖拽到导轨的3号槽,系统将自动弹出dp接口属性对话框
6. 在对话框address下拉框中设置dp站地址为2,单击new按钮添加新子网
7. 添加子网profbus(1),单击选项页“network setting”
8. 选择prfibus总线传输速率为1.5mbps,profile中选择standard,单击所有属性对话框ok按钮
9. 编译保存s7-400站点硬件组态,下载到s7-400 cpu中
10. 从菜单栏option下configure network命令进入网络组态界面
11. 如右图所示,右键单击cpu414-3dp,在弹出对话框中选择insert new connection命令,插入一个新连接
12. a) 选择unspecified连接伙伴,
b) 连接类型菜单中选择s7 connection,单击ok按钮,弹出s7 connection属性对话框 西门子cpu412-3h
13. s7 connection属性对话框设置:
a) 选中established an active connection
b) interface选择cpu414-3 dp,dp(r0/s3)
c) 设置伙伴profibus地址3
d) 设置本地id为1
e) 点击address details按钮
14. address detail对话框设置
a) 设置安装cpu的机架号0
b) 设置安装cpu的插槽号,对于s7-300,cpu只能安装在2号槽
c) 设置连接资源号,对于s7单边连接,连接资源号总是3
设置完成后可看到伙伴tsap为03.02,点击ok按钮关闭属性对话框
其它类似信息

推荐信息